If you're asking about the ad that wanted $895 for the rack bench , lat attachment and weight set, yes it's way too high. If I wanted that set up bad enough, the most I would pay is about $400 and only because the weights are with it. I bought that same set up new in 2004 and everything new including tax was only about $850, and that rack and bench is older than mine was.

[QUOTE=sparco;1572287841]Yes, it is mine. Would love your constructive feedback on a fair price for the items.[/QUOTE]
50 cents a lb for weights. Maybe 400 for the cage. 100 for all the attatchments.
So maybe 800 is reasonable.
